History & Origin
Allura comes from the word allure — from French alurer, 'to attract, to entice, to charm' — hence 'allure, enchantment, fascination'. A glamorous, modern word-name (the Voltron princess Allura).
It registers thinly in records. Rare, allure-and-enchantment at the root, and glamorous.

Frequently Asked
What does the name Allura mean?
Allura evokes 'allure' — French 'to attract, to charm; enchantment, fascination'.
How do you pronounce Allura?
It's said ə-LOOR-ah /əˈlʊr.ɑ/ — three syllables, stress on the second.
Is Allura a boy or girl name?
Allura is a girl's name.
How popular is Allura?
Allura is a rare, recent name in the U.S.
